(NHC)NiCp2 complexes: new air-stable thermally activated precatalysts for olefin hydroheteroarylation

Abstract

Readily available air-stable (NHC)NiCp2 complexes (NHC is N-heterocyclic carbene, Cp is cyclopentadienyl anion ligand) can be used as efficient thermally activated precatalysts for hydroheteroarylation of olefins with various heteroarenes. According to preliminary mechanistic studies, precatalyst activation may involve reductive elimination of two Cp ligands to give 1,1’’-bi(cyclopenta-2,4-diene) and (NHC)Ni0 active species under elevated temperature.
